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Arizona Pocket Mouse | mulgara |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Dasyuromorphia (Dasyuromorphia) |
| Family | Heteromyidae | Dasyuridae |
| Genus | Perognathus | Dasycercus |
| Species | Perognathus amplus | Dasycercus cristicauda |
Evolutionary Relationship
Arizona Pocket Mouse and mulgara share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
